It may be a solution, but I am not certain :-) Because we have had posters saying that the safety symbols disappeared while upgrading from NIS 2009 to NIS 2010 (in which case a reinstallation of NIS 2010 solved the problem)...On the other hand, why not benefit from the fact that you can upgrade for free to NIS 2010 and be equipped with the latest security software? :-)

 

You can either upgrade to NIS 2010 via the Norton Update Center (in-place upgrade), or you can install NIS 2010 over NIS 2009 by downloading and saving the full NIS 2010 installation package in advance to your computer (which may be better, that way you perform the upgrade without being connected to the internet; when NIS 2010 installs itself and it is time for it to activate itself, it will prompt you to connect to the internet; also, I just remembered that some posters ended up with a different-language version of NIS after upgrading via the Update Center) and installing it over NIS 2009. During the upgrade process, please be patient; NIS 2010 will uninstall NIS 2009, reboot your computer, then install itself. Please keep your product key ready just in case (it should be picked up automatically by NIS 2010) and also back up your Identity Safe data to be on the safe side.
